Verdict

The Blackview Oscal Pad 10 4G is a budget-friendly 10.1-inch tablet featuring a 1920x1200 FHD IPS display and powered by an octa-core Unisoc T606 processor. It is equipped with 8GB of physical RAM (expandable by up to 6GB via virtual memory), 128GB of internal storage (expandable to 1TB), and a 6,580mAh battery. Main characteristics include a 13MP Sony rear camera, 8MP Samsung front camera, dual SIM 4G support, and the Doke OS_P 3.0 interface based on Android 12. Its primary pros are its vibrant high-resolution screen, generous memory for its price class, and a dedicated PC mode for multitasking with mouse and keyboard support. However, notable cons include its relatively heavy 536g build, a modest 60Hz refresh rate that limits high-end gaming, and slower 10W charging speeds.

Third-party reviews

What customers like about Blackview Oscal Pad 10 4G (8GB + 128GB)?

  • Exceptional value for money at its price point
  • Sharp display with vibrant colors and good viewing stability
  • Generous amount of RAM and storage for a budget device
  • Includes useful accessories like a protective flip case and screen protector
  • Features a dedicated PC mode for improved productivity
  • Solid build quality and modern semi-flat-edged design

What customers dislike about Blackview Oscal Pad 10 4G (8GB + 128GB)?

  • Inconsistent battery performance; some users report rapid drain
  • Low screen refresh rate (58Hz) makes it less suitable for high-end gaming
  • Charging speed is relatively slow, taking nearly three hours
  • Occasional reports of slow performance or unresponsive touch inputs
  • Camera quality is basic and only suitable for document scanning or casual video calls
  • Display brightness may reset unexpectedly after waking from sleep
